Yea, the oil cap. The silver one has been around and still is, but not many people know that there was once a Gold version. Its been discontinued for a while now, and rarely ever pop up. I've seen a few spring type Gold caps, and actually know one person who has one, but have never seen the screw on type. You'd be lucky to come across a spring type Gold cap, but it seems the screw on type is the hardest one to find.

Are you sure its not a knock off piece? there a ton of them on ebay with trd stickers.

I'm positive. You can tell the knock offs from the genuine, especially the gold one.

The cap itself is shaped a little different, the gold color is different, and the sticker on the original is actually an aluminum decal compared to the knock offs gel coated looking foil. Can also tell by looking at the lettering and logo. The genuine has sharper edges, flatter face, and is actually aluminum. Knock offs lettering and logo are more burred, not as sharp, has a gel coat over a foil look. The machining is also a lot cleaner on the genuine parts. You can actually see the machining marks on the knock offs.
